1994 Vauxhall Tigra vs. 2010 Honda Accord Crosstour
To start off, 2010 Honda Accord Crosstour is newer by 16 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1994 Vauxhall Tigra.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1994 Vauxhall Tigra would be higher. At 3,500 cc (6 cylinders), 2010 Honda Accord Crosstour is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2010 Honda Accord Crosstour (271 HP) has 182 more horse power than 1994 Vauxhall Tigra. (89 HP) In normal driving conditions, 2010 Honda Accord Crosstour should accelerate faster than 1994 Vauxhall Tigra.
Both vehicles are front wheel drive (FWD). Which offers better traction when its slippery than rear w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2010 Honda Accord Crosstour (344 Nm) has 219 more torque (in Nm) than 1994 Vauxhall Tigra. (125 Nm). This means 2010 Honda Accord Crosstour will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1994 Vauxhall Tigra.
